首页 > 代码库 > Python基础之文件操作流与函数
Python基础之文件操作流与函数
一.文件操作
打开文件的方式有:
- r,只读模式(默认)
- w,只写模式(不可读;不存在则创建;存在则删除内容;)
- a,追加模式(可读; 不存在则创建;存在则只追加内容;)
"+"表示可以同时读写某个文件
- r+,可读写文件(可读;可写)
- w+,写读文件(可写;可读)
- a+,同a
"b"表示处理二进制文件
- rb
- wb
1."r"读取文件,并将文件输出出来,encoding="utf-8"是将文件读取出来以后转换成utf-8格式,在windows下防止因为编译格式问题乱码。
f = open("文件.txt", "r", encoding="utf-8") data = http://www.mamicode.com/f.read()
f.close print(data)
2."w"写入文件,将之前的文件清空后写入。
f = open("文件.txt", "w", encoding="utf-8") f.write("炎黄子孙")
f.close
3."a"写入文件,不清空之前的文件,将光标移到文件的最后,追加写入。
f = open("文件.txt", "a", encoding="utf-8") f.write("\n炎黄子孙") f.close()
4.
Python基础之文件操作流与函数
声明:以上内容来自用户投稿及互联网公开渠道收集整理发布,本网站不拥有所有权,未作人工编辑处理,也不承担相关法律责任,若内容有误或涉及侵权可进行投诉: 投诉/举报 工作人员会在5个工作日内联系你,一经查实,本站将立刻删除涉嫌侵权内容。